Strategic Commissioning Plan - Third Sector Engagement Session

The South Lanarkshire Integration Joint Board (IJB) has begun to consult on the development of their new Strategic Commissioning Plan 2025 – 2028. This new Plan will have an important role in guiding the prioritisation of significant resources and the provision of services in particular by South Lanarkshire University Health and Social Care Partnership (HSCP) over the next three years.

Joanne McMann, Engagement Lead at VASLan, has been interviewing people from across South Lanarkshire who have benefited from third sector services. The organisations who delivered these vital services and support all received funding from the Communities Mental Health and Wellbeing Fund (CMHWF).

This report aims to demonstrate the necessity of local third sector organisations and advocate for fairer funding. We want to say a big thank you to everyone who took part and shared their story.
